Thay đổi phím tắt của cmd + Q cho tất cả các ứng dụng


9

Tôi sử dụng cmd+ tab, cmd+ W, cmd+ Arất nhiều và tôi không nhớ mình đã vô tình đánh cmd+ bao nhiêu lần Q.

Có thể thay đổi lối tắt để thoát ứng dụng từ cmd+ Qsang thứ khác (không cho phép sử dụng bàn phím để thoát ứng dụng), lý tưởng cho tất cả các ứng dụng cùng một lúc (không làm từng ứng dụng cho từng ứng dụng)?


Tôi nghĩ rằng việc thay đổi nó trong phần Bàn phím của Tùy chọn hệ thống, bên dưới Phím tắt có thể hoạt động, nhưng nó không ở đây. Trừ khi tôi cần khởi động lại để thấy sự thay đổi.
George C

Câu trả lời:


3

Điều này sẽ thay đổi phím tắt thành ⇧⌘Q cho hầu hết các ứng dụng được cài đặt hiện tại:

defaults write -g NSUserKeyEquivalents -dict-add $(mdfind kMDItemContentType==com.apple.application-bundle | grep -v { | sed 's/.*\//Quit /g;s/\.app$//g;'"s/'/\\''\\'/g;s/^/'/g;s/$/' '\$@q'/g" | uniq | tr '\n' ' ')

Bạn cũng có thể sử dụng KeyRemap4MacBook để thay đổi ⌘Q thành một số tổ hợp phím khác hoặc yêu cầu giữ hoặc nhấn hai lần để thoát khỏi ứng dụng.


Có cách nào để chỉnh sửa cơ sở dữ liệu này một cách trực quan? Đó là một ninja dòng lệnh điên di chuyển bạn đã có ở đó! ;)
Hari Karam Singh

2
Hoặc bạn có thể dạy tôi cách của bạn?
Hari Karam Singh

1

Howtogeek dành cả một bài viết về chủ đề này và họ đã cung cấp một hướng dẫn tuyệt vời về cách làm điều này. Về cơ bản, nó đi xuống để ghi đè chức năng mặc định.

nhập mô tả hình ảnh ở đây

NHƯNG có một nhược điểm (rất lớn), nếu bạn làm theo cách đó, bạn sẽ phải làm điều này cho MỌI ứng dụng bạn sử dụng, có thể hơi khó hiểu ...
Vì vậy, họ cung cấp giải pháp thay vì giải pháp vững chắc .


3
Câu hỏi của tôi đề cập rằng "cho tất cả các ứng dụng cùng một lúc (không phải làm từng ứng dụng một)".
powerboy
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.